We are off here for our third time in 3 years. It's a converted barn and is clean and spacious. The owners are lovely and have 3 dogs of their own. There is a grass airstrip where you can let your dogs off lead safely and no picking up poo! The only rule is no dogs in the owners pond - guess where my two visit as soon as they arrive?

If you want a quiet country holiday you can just stay at the cottage. There is a private garden overlooking fields and lots of space for the dogs to roam safely and freely. Molly and Zak potter about no problem and the 3 little dogs that live there will pop in for a visit from time to time.

We use as a base and tend to go out everyday for a walk on a beach. There is a village 10 mins walk away and if you get in the car will find a supermarket close by. There is a pub in the village that does meals or you can cook at the cottage.
